[英]Find the minimum and maximum number in an Array in Java
I'm new to programming.我是编程新手。 I want to find the maximum and minimum number in a given array.我想找到给定数组中的最大和最小数字。 So I wrote this code.所以我写了这段代码。 Although this gives the correct minimum number, it gives multiple maximum numbers.虽然这给出了正确的最小数字,但它给出了多个最大数字。 Can someone help me with this?有人可以帮我弄这个吗?
package maximumandminimum;
public class Maximumandminimum {公共类最大和最小{
public static void main(String[] args)
{
int arr[] = {33,55,80,90,12,56,78};
int min = arr[0];
int max = arr[0];
for(int i = 0; i< arr.length;i++)
{
if(arr[i]<min){
min= arr[i];
System.out.println("minumum number is"+min);
}
if(arr[i]>max){
max = arr[i];
System.out.println("maximum number is"+max);
}
}
}
} }
This has been solved here: Finding the max/min value in an array of primitives using Java这已在这里解决: Find the max/min value in a array of originals using Java
Don't forget to print outside the loop (to get one answer).不要忘记在循环外打印(以获得一个答案)。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.